Our product range includes a wide range of cumin seeds, pesticide free cumin seed and IPM cumin seed.Cumin has been in use since ancient times. Seeds excavated at the Syrian site Tell ed-Der have been dated to the second millennium BC. They have also been reported from several New Kingdom levels of ancient Egyptian archaeological sites.

Specifications
| Parameters | Values |
|---|---|
| Type | Machine cleaned / Sortexed/Extra Bold |
| Purity | 99% / 98% / 99.50% (Singapore/Europe) |
| Total ASH | 9.50% Max |
| Acid insuluble ASH: | 1.75% Max |
| Flavors | Aromatic with a penetrating flavour |
| Moisture | 10% max |
| Salmonella | Absent/25 gms |
| Volaile oil | Min 2.00 ml/100 gms |
